The Course on Computer Concepts (CCC) is one of the most popular IT literacy programs in India, designed by NIELIT (National Institute of Electronics & Information Technology).

It’s essentially the "gold standard" for entry-level digital literacy. Whether you're looking to secure a government job or just want to stop asking your younger cousin how to attach a file to an email, this course covers the essentials.

### Course Objective

The primary goal is to empower individuals to use computers for professional and personal tasks. By the end of the course, a candidate is expected to be digitally confident in:

  • Preparing business letters and spreadsheets.
  • Navigating the internet and using email.
  • Understanding social media and Digital Financial Services.
  • Staying safe in the world of cyber security.

### Detailed Syllabus Breakdown

The CCC curriculum is updated periodically to stay relevant with modern technology (like transitioning from Microsoft Office to LibreOffice).

ModuleTopicKey Focus Areas1Introduction to ComputerHardware, Software, CPU, and Input/Output devices.

2:Introduction to OSBasics of Windows and Linux-based Operating Systems (Ubuntu).

3:Word ProcessingCreating, editing, and formatting documents (LibreOffice Writer).

4:SpreadsheetsUsing formulas, functions, and charts (LibreOffice Calc).

5:PresentationsDesigning slides and adding animations (LibreOffice Impress).

6:Internet & WWWWeb browsers, search engines, and LAN/WAN basics.

7:E-mail, Social NetworkingEmail etiquette, Facebook, Twitter, and E-Governance.

8:Digital Financial ToolsOTP, UPI, AEPS, USSD, and Internet Banking.

9:Cyber SecurityPhishing, Malware, and securing your PC/Smartphone.### Examination Pattern

To get that certificate, you have to clear the online exam. Here is the lowdown:

  • Total Marks: 100
  • Duration: 60 Minutes
  • Format: Objective Type (Multiple Choice Questions)
  • Negative Marking: None (so go ahead and take a calculated guess!)
  • Passing Criteria: You need a minimum of 50% to pass.

Grading Scale:

The certificate doesn't just say "Pass"—it gives you a grade based on your performance:

  • S: 85% and above
  • A: 75% – 84%
  • B: 65% – 74%
  • C: 55% – 64%
  • D: 50% – 54%
  • F: Below 50% (Fail)


### Why Should You Take It?

  1. Government Requirement: Many state government jobs (especially in UP, Gujarat, and Maharashtra) mandate a CCC certificate for clerical and administrative roles.
  2. Digital Literacy: It moves you beyond "just browsing" to actually understanding how digital systems work.
  3. Short Duration: The total course duration is only 80 hours (usually completed in 2 weeks to 2 months depending on your pace).
Note: There are no formal eligibility criteria to sit for the exam. Anyone, regardless of their age or educational background, can apply.

The **Course on Computer Concepts (CCC)** by NIELIT is a foundational certification designed to provide digital literacy to the general public. It’s practical, comprehensive, and covers everything from basic hardware to the nuances of digital financial tools.


Here is the structured syllabus based on the latest NIELIT curriculum:


---


## 1. Introduction to Computer & GUI Based Operating Systems


This module covers the hardware-software relationship and how to navigate modern interfaces.


* **Computer Basics:** History, generations, and types of computers.

* **Hardware & Software:** Central Processing Unit (CPU), input/output devices, and types of software (System vs. Application).

* **Operating Systems:** Basics of Windows and Linux (Ubuntu), taskbar, icons, and managing files/folders.


---


## 2. Word Processing (LibreOffice Writer/MS Word)


Focuses on creating professional documents.


* **Editing:** Cutting, copying, pasting, and undo/redo.

* **Formatting:** Font styles, alignment, bullets, and numbering.

* **Advanced Tools:** Tables, Mail Merge, and autocorrect features.


---


## 3. Spreadsheet (LibreOffice Calc/MS Excel)


Designed for data management and basic calculations.


* **Basics:** Cells, rows, columns, and worksheets.

* **Formulas:** Using basic math (, , , ).

* **Functions:** SUM, COUNT, AVERAGE, MAX, MIN, and IF.

* **Charts:** Creating visual representations of data (Bar, Pie, Line).


---


## 4. Presentation (LibreOffice Impress/MS PowerPoint)


Skills for creating effective visual slideshows.


* **Creation:** Adding slides, text boxes, and images.

* **Design:** Applying themes, backgrounds, and slide transitions.

* **Animation:** Adding motion effects to objects.


---


## 5. Introduction to Internet, WWW, and Web Browsers


The "how-to" of navigating the online world.


* **Networks:** LAN, WAN, MAN, and VPN.

* **Browsing:** Using search engines, bookmarks, and history.

* **Connectivity:** Understanding ISP, Wi-Fi, and IP addresses.


---


## 6. Communication and Collaboration


Focuses on digital interaction.


* **Email:** Creating accounts, CC/BCC, attachments, and signatures.

* **Social Media:** Facebook, Twitter, LinkedIn, and Instagram basics.

* **Instant Messaging:** WhatsApp, Telegram, and video conferencing (Zoom/Meet).


---


## 7. Digital Financial Tools and Applications


Essential knowledge for the modern cashless economy.


* **Banking:** OTP, QR Codes, UPI, AEPS, and USSD.

* **Payment Apps:** Using BHIM, Google Pay, and PhonePe.

* **Security:** Understanding IMPS, NEFT, and RTGS.


---


## 8. Overview of Future Skills & Cyber Security


Looking ahead at emerging tech and staying safe online.


* **Emerging Tech:** IoT (Internet of Things), Cloud Computing, Big Data, and AI.

* **Cyber Security:** Phishing, Malware, Firewalls, and best practices for password management.
